Transaction afdb0aeaccc5742bd76429ffdbe11169eb8550afbca71c1066f458608b88bd5e
1 Input
2 Outputs
- afdb0aeaccc5742bd76429ffdbe11169eb8550afbca71c1066f458608b88bd5e:0
- afdb0aeaccc5742bd76429ffdbe11169eb8550afbca71c1066f458608b88bd5e:1
value 339562
address 3D3hg2ChZsqbe33QVR7yk6qUZjY5z52cjL
value 390540
address 19B1fxppTGf2QYCenMFz6WJsEStKPeXwKR